Update SAMA5D2-XULT entry point

- in NuttX 11.x and 12.x the nuttx entry point
  for the sama5d2-xult board changed to 0x20008E20
  (from 0x2008040).

  This change updates defconfigs and the README.txt
  to reflect that.

- no code changes
